Understand how mortgages work, the key players involved, and the basic structure of a home loan.
- A mortgage is a secured loan using the property as collateral
- Principal, interest, taxes, and insurance make up your monthly payment
- Loan terms typically range from 15 to 30 years
Learn what influences mortgage rates and how to lock in the best rate for your situation.
- Rates are influenced by the Federal Reserve, bond markets, and your credit profile
- A rate lock protects you from market fluctuations during processing
- Even a 0.25% rate difference can save thousands over the loan term
Master DTI — the ratio lenders use to measure your ability to manage monthly payments.
- DTI compares your monthly debts to your gross monthly income
- Most programs require a DTI of 43% or lower
- Lower DTI means better rates and more loan options
How credit scores affect your mortgage options, rates, and what you can do to improve yours.
- Most loan programs require a minimum score of 580–620
- Higher scores unlock lower rates and better terms
- Paying down revolving debt is the fastest way to boost your score
Everything about conventional mortgages — requirements, PMI, and when they make sense.
- Requires 620+ credit score and as little as 3% down
- PMI is removable once you reach 20% equity
- Available for primary, second homes, and investment properties
Government-backed loans with lower barriers to entry — perfect for first-time buyers.
- Only 3.5% down payment required with 580+ credit
- More lenient DTI requirements (up to 57% in some cases)
- MIP is required for the life of the loan (unless 10%+ down)
